Marathon Runtime: The 10000mAh Battery and 2-Hour Charging

The Achilles' heel of portable speakers is the battery. There's nothing worse than having your speaker run out of battery at the height of the party. The Sounarc L2 This problem is solved with a massive 10000mAh battery (which according to the technical data is 14.8V/2500mAh, which corresponds to 37Wh, which is the same as the capacity of a 10000mAh 3.7V power bank).

This huge battery, according to the manufacturer, allows for **13 hours of playback time** at 50% volume. In practice, this means that the Sounarc L2 It can handle a full afternoon of grilling and a night of partying on a single charge. The real problem it solves: no need to party near an outlet, Sounarc L2 it truly gives you portable freedom.

What's even more impressive is the charging time. According to the specifications, the charging time is just **2 hours**. This is incredibly fast for a battery this size, and suggests that the Sounarc L2 It is not powered by a slow USB port, but by the included AC 100-240V power adapter, with a built-in fast charger. It is ready to go again for the next party in a few hours.

Main features in summary:

  • Sound system: 2.2 channel
  • Performance: 80W Peak Power
  • Lighting: Dynamic RGB light show, with beat synchronization (Beat Sync)
  • Battery: 10000mAh (14.8V/2500mAh)
  • Play time: 13 hours (at 50% volume)
  • Charging time: 2 hours (with AC power charger)
  • Protection: Splash-proof
  • Inputs: Dual microphone/guitar input with echo adjustment
  • Connection: Wireless 5.3, AUX, USB, TF card
  • Extra features: TWS stereo pairing, Multiple EQ modes, Built-in mobile holder

Q: What exactly does 80W “Peak Power” mean?
A: Peak power is the maximum short-term surge that a speaker can deliver, such as at a musical climax. This is what gives the sound its dynamics. Continuous, sustained power (RMS) is lower, but a peak value of 80W indicates serious volume.

Q: Is the Sounarc L2 fully waterproof? Can I take it into the pool?
A: No. The Sounarc L2 “Splash-proof.” This means that splashes of water from the pool, the sandy, humid beach air, or a sudden rain shower will not damage it, but it should not be immersed in water or permanently exposed to a jet of water.

Q: Does a 10000mAh battery really charge in just 2 hours?
A: Yes, this data seems to be real. The Sounarc L2 It charges not via USB, but via its own built-in AC 100-240V charging unit, which allows for much faster charging speeds than a standard 5V USB port.
